counterbalance \coun`terbal"ance\ -b?l"ans, v. t. imp. p.
p. counterbalanced -anst; p. pr. vb. n.
counterbalancing.
to oppose with an equal weight or power; to counteract the
power or effect of; to countervail; to equiponderate; to
balance.
1913 webster
the remaining air was not able to counterbalance the
mercurial cylinder. --boyle.
1913 webster
the study of mind is necessary to counterbalance and
correct the influence of the study of nature. --sir w.
hamilton.

counterbalancing
adj : serving to equilibrate; "he added a counterbalancing weight"
